Palm Beach & Hawkesbury River Cruises has been operating since 2000, "Merinda II" is a fifty foot timber passenger ferry built by Norman Wright and Sones in 1983. Overall the experience is memorable & is worth the money. The boat travels from Palm Beach to Cowan Creek, but drops off and picks up passengers at Patonga, Cottage Point Inn and Bobbin Head.
